Liverpool 3-0 West Brom

Robbie Keane scored his first Premier League goals for Liverpool as they beat West Brom to go three points clear of Chelsea at the top of the table.

A combination of Scott Carson’s body and Jonas Olsson’s arm prevented Yossi Benayoun’s shot opening the scoring.

But there was no stopping Keane when he latched on to Steven Gerrard’s pass before clipping the ball over Carson.

Keane scored his second goal when he rounded Carson and slotted home before Alvaro Arbeloa curled in a late third.

Keane will be delighted to get off the mark in the league, following his £20m summer move from Tottenham.

Tottenham 2-1 Liverpool

Roman Pavlyuchenko scored a late winner as Tottenham came from behind to beat Liverpool and haul themselves off the foot off the Premier League table.

Dirk Kuyt put Liverpool ahead when he smashed in a shot on three minutes.

Darren Bent sliced a clearance against his own post before Steven Gerrard hit the post with a deflected shot and then saw his lob cannon back off the bar.

Jamie Carragher headed into his own net to give Spurs hope and Pavlyuchenko tapped in from Bent’s cross to win it.

It was a remarkable turnaround for Tottenham, whose fortunes have been completely revived under the stewardship of new boss Harry Redknapp.

Liverpool 1-0 Portsmouth

Steven Gerrard’s 76th-minute penalty kept Liverpool clear at the top of the table with victory over Portsmouth.

Gerrard scored after Papa Bouba Diop undid his side’s resolute performance by handling a corner in Pompey boss Tony Adams’s first game in charge.

Until then, Dirk Kuyt’s shot against the post was the closest Liverpool had come to a goal.

Yossi Benayoun was also denied for the home side after a last-ditch Sylvain Distin tackle before Gerrard’s winner.

Chelsea 0-1 Liverpool

Liverpool demonstrated their growing title credentials by ending Chelsea’s 86-game unbeaten run in the Premier League at Stamford Bridge and moving three points clear at the top of the table.

Xabi Alonso’s deflected 10th-minute goal gave Liverpool victory and shattered a Chelsea sequence stretching back to February 2004 on home turf.

It was a deserved triumph for Rafael Benitez’s side achieved without Fernando Torres and the first setback for the reign of Luiz Felipe Scolari at Chelsea.
